Revenue Streams and Growth Drivers

Digging deeper into the revenue streams and growth drivers from the Bank of America 2023 Annual Report, we see a clear picture of where the money is coming from and how they're expanding. One of the biggest contributors continues to be their net interest income. With interest rates rising, BofA was able to benefit from the wider net interest margin, meaning they earned more on the loans they made compared to what they paid on deposits. This is a significant boost to their top line. Beyond interest income, their non-interest income is also a crucial piece of the puzzle. This includes revenue from fees, service charges, investment banking activities, and wealth management. Their wealth management division, Merrill Lynch, and their investment banking arm, BofA Securities, are powerhouses. They provide a wide array of services, from financial advice and investment management to mergers and acquisitions advisory. The report shows consistent growth in these areas, reflecting strong client relationships and a robust deal pipeline. Profitability and Earnings Per Share (EPS)

Now, let's talk profitability and Earnings Per Share (EPS) as detailed in the Bank of America 2023 Annual Report. This is what investors really look at, right? BofA demonstrated solid profitability throughout the year. Despite the economic headwinds, they managed to generate substantial earnings. The report breaks down their net income figures, showing a healthy bottom line. While EPS can fluctuate based on factors like share buybacks and the overall market performance, BofA's EPS remained strong, reflecting their ability to generate value for shareholders. Earnings per share is a critical metric because it tells you how much profit a company makes for each share of its stock. A higher EPS generally indicates a more profitable company. In 2023, BofA's EPS showcased their earning power. They achieved this profitability through a combination of strong revenue generation and effective cost management, which we touched upon earlier. Strategic expense control was paramount. They’ve been investing in technology to automate processes and improve efficiency, which helps keep their operating costs in check. This allows more of the revenue generated to flow down to the bottom line as profit. Furthermore, the bank's diversified business model plays a huge role in its consistent profitability. When one segment might be facing headwinds, another might be performing exceptionally well, balancing things out. Their risk management practices also contribute significantly. By prudently managing credit risk, market risk, and operational risk, they avoid major losses that could derail profitability. Digital Transformation and Technology Investments

Let's really zoom in on the digital transformation and technology investments discussed in the Bank of America 2023 Annual Report. Guys, this is a massive area for BofA, and it's fundamentally changing how they operate and interact with customers. They're pouring billions into technology, and it's not just for show; it's about staying competitive and meeting the demands of today's digital-first world. A huge part of this is enhancing their digital banking platforms, especially their mobile app and online banking services. They're constantly adding new features, improving user interfaces, and making it easier for customers to manage their accounts, make payments, and access financial advice – all from their phones. This focus on seamless digital experiences is crucial for retaining and attracting younger demographics. Beyond customer-facing tech, BofA is also investing heavily in data analytics and artificial intelligence (AI). They're using AI to personalize customer interactions, detect fraud more effectively, automate back-office processes, and gain deeper insights into market trends. Imagine an AI assistant that can help you with your banking queries 24/7, or algorithms that can predict and prevent potential financial crimes. That's the kind of innovation happening. Cloud computing is another significant area of investment. Migrating more of their infrastructure to the cloud allows for greater scalability, flexibility, and cost efficiency. It enables them to deploy new technologies faster and more reliably. They are also modernizing their core banking systems, replacing older infrastructure with more agile, API-driven platforms. This makes it easier to integrate new services and respond to changing market demands.
